The Role

The role will support the Finance Manager with the day to day running of the accounts function, as well as take on the Management Accounts aspect of the role. As the various business entities grow, you will be able to take on more responsibility and gain more development in the role. The role would be ideal for someone experienced in the transactional and month end elements of accounts, or someone currently in an Assistant Management Accountant role, looking to progress and develop. The primary responsibilities for the role are to ensure accuracy and completeness of the accounts, whilst supporting the Finance Manager and the Finance Director with the timely close of the month end process, to underpin the business in being able to continually operate in what is a dynamic and fast paced industry.

Key Responsibilities and Duties:
  • Prepare the management accounts at month end, ensuring month-end close is delivered in a timely manner.
  • Balance sheet reconciliations to be completed on a monthly basis across all group companies
  • Deliver both scheduled reporting where required for various month end packs, and ad-hoc reporting and analysis as and when required by the business
  • Support the Finance Manager with the day to day transactional accounting where needed and cover holidays
  • Processing invoices on the Sales and Purchase Ledger
  • Bank reconciliations
  • Forex/multicurrency calculations
  • VAT returns
  • Assisting with system efficiencies
  • Ensure adherence to month end timetable
  • Any other ad-hoc finance tasks as required
